FDA monitored : There are dozens of commercial formulas but most are similar. They are not better than breast milk but try to mimic it. It can be found in ready to feed (they add water), or powder (you add water. The protein source varies from cow milk to soy bean or elemental proteins. The sugar content & source varies. All are monitored in the US by the FDA & must meet their standards for content.
